States Where You Can Bet on the Kentucky Derby Online
Thanks to a differing set of legislation for race books, the ability to wager legally online on horse races is much more widespread than traditional sports betting, which is regulated in only a handful of states.
Here are all of the states where legal betting on the Kentucky Derby online betting is available:
- Arkansas
- California
- Colorado
- Connecticut
- Delaware
- Florida
- Idaho
- Illinois
- Indiana
- Iowa
- Kentucky
- Louisiana
- Maryland
- Massachusetts
- Michigan
- Minnesota
- Montana
- New Hampshire
- New Mexico
- New York
- North Dakota
- Ohio
- Oregon
- Rhode Island
- South Dakota
- Vermont
- Virginia
- Washington
- West Virginia
- Wyoming

Types of Bets You Can Place on the Kentucky Derby
The great thing about horse racing is that you can place a lot more than just a single bet on a horse to win. You can choose the top three horses, the order of finish, and so on, providing prospective bettors with a variety of ways to wager and win.
Betting terms to know:
- Win: Horse to win the race
- Place: Horse to finish second
- Show: Horse to finish third
Here are the various types of bets for the Kentucky Derby:
- Exacta: picking the first 2 horses
- Trifecta: 3 horses
- Superfecta: 4 horses
- Super High Five: 5 horses
- Win-Place-Show: bet on a horse to finish in a certain spot
